Stocks are more than just pieces of paper made for buying and selling. While you own them, you are a member of a collective ownership of the company in question. You are then entitled to both claims and earnings on assets. Sometimes you are allowed to vote in big elections concerning corporate leadership.

Too many people concentrate on attempting to strike it rich quickly by buying stock in small companies. They miss out on the benefits that can be reaped from a portfolio of stable, blue-chip companies with modest but reliable long-term growth. While selecting companies for potential growth is the key, you should always balance your portfolio with several major companies as well. Larger corporations are likely to provide consistent growth based on strong past performance.

When analyzing a particular company, take a closer look at how its equity is associated to the voting rights inside the company. For example, some companies have management who only hold a small percentage of the stock, yet their votes account for 70% of the overall results. This should be a red flag warning to avoid the company’s stock.
